WebDec 13, 2024 · You can put them in coffins. If you have an engraved slab though, there's two way to get rid of the bodies 1)(hard) Dump in magma 2)(easy) Build a large raising bridge. Link it to a lever, and raise. Put a corpse stockpile beneath it. Pull the lever. It should obliterate any item beneath it, and be gone next time you raise it. They are usually an indication that you need more food storage items like stone pots or barrels. Leaving food lying out - even in your stockpile - will tend to cause small swarms of flies around your food and (possibly) make it rot quicker.
